Additive Manufacturing Australia: Building Big, Fast, and Locally

WAAM is a form of Directed Energy Deposition (DED) that uses a robotic welding arm and wire feedstock to build large-scale metal parts layer by layer. Unlike powder-bed systems, WAAM is ideal for creating oversized industrial components such as structural supports, impellers, flanges, and housings. This is especially valuable in Australia, where many industries operate in remote or hard-to-reach areas, from mining operations in Western Australia to offshore engineering in the Northern Territory and shipyards in New South Wales. WAAM makes it possible to produce mission-critical parts locally, reduce reliance on overseas suppliers, and significantly shorten lead times.

 

WAAM System Supplier Australia: In-House Robotic 3D Printing

MX3D provides fully integrated WAAM systems to Australian companies ready to take control of their metal component production. Each system includes a multi-axis industrial robot, a high-performance welding source, and our proprietary MetalXL software for real-time control of heat input, deposition settings, and geometry optimization. From Brisbane to Melbourne, Adelaide, and Perth, manufacturers can implement robotic metal 3D printing to produce components faster, with less material waste and more design flexibility. The systems are scalable and compatible with existing production environments, making them ideal for rail manufacturing, heavy equipment production, industrial tooling, and maintenance.

 

On-Demand Metal 3D Printing Australia: Fast, Certified, and Custom

For companies that require high-quality parts without investing in their own equipment, MX3D offers certified on-demand metal 3D printing services for Australia. Parts are produced using advanced WAAM processes and alloys such as stainless steel 316L, Inconel, and duplex steel, meeting international standards including ISO, ASME, and API. Australian industries such as rail repair, mining maintenance, and defense procurement use this service to replace obsolete or urgently needed parts. WAAM’s ability to produce large, high-value components without tooling makes it an efficient option for low-volume and specialized production.

 

Metal Additive Manufacturing Australia: Industry-Specific Benefits

WAAM is especially suited to Australia’s industrial sectors:

  • Mining and Resources: WAAM supports the production of wear-resistant parts, repair components, and custom tooling needed for continuous operations in mining and mineral processing.
  • Rail and Transportation: Rail operators can print structural reinforcements, housings, and replacement parts quickly, reducing downtime and supply chain risk.
  • Defense and Aerospace Tooling: For non-flight-critical applications, WAAM enables local fabrication of robust components with full traceability.
  • Marine and Offshore Engineering: WAAM can produce corrosion-resistant parts and structural elements tailored to Australia’s coastal and offshore infrastructure needs.

This level of sector fit makes WAAM a valuable technology for reducing manufacturing delays, increasing operational autonomy, and improving serviceability across regions.

Sustainable Manufacturing in Australia: Local Parts, Less Waste

With sustainability becoming a priority, WAAM supports Australia’s shift toward circular manufacturing and low-waste production. The process minimizes material waste, using up to 90 percent of input wire, and removes the need to hold large spare part inventories. Producing components on demand and closer to their final point of use helps companies cut transport-related emissions and align with ESG and net-zero goals. WAAM’s efficient material usage and energy performance make it a strong choice for environmentally conscious manufacturing.
